Output dc59b7691d9671cc9195ef40e5bdaba51a6f0ab2a01997aa255594338fc8929c:43

value
109890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2b2c275536586f8ba65a2018bfe76f1eff46fb7 OP_EQUALVERIFY OP_CHECKSIG
address
1HHsRagfxtVKAqHhaueVeXYVwfT82rAQvY
transaction
dc59b7691d9671cc9195ef40e5bdaba51a6f0ab2a01997aa255594338fc8929c
spent
true